Average memory care costs in BELLEVIEW, Florida are $4,197 per month. They can go as high as $6,942 or go as low as $2,544 per month, depending on the type of dementia care community you are considering, and their location. For comparison purposes, Marion county and Florida average daily memory care monthly costs are $4,327 and $4,598 respectively.

How do I know if my loved one needs memory care in Belleview, Florida?

Determining whether your loved one requires memory care in Belleview, FL involves assessing their cognitive abilities, safety, and overall well-being. Common signs that may indicate the need for memory care include memory loss, confusion, wandering, difficulty with daily tasks, and behavioral changes. It's essential to consult with a healthcare professional or a geriatric specialist who can conduct assessments to evaluate your loved one's specific needs and recommend the appropriate level of care.

How is the safety and security of residents ensured in memory care communities?

Safety and security are top priorities in memory care communities. These communities typically have secure living environments with measures such as locked doors, keypad entry systems, and trained staff to prevent residents from wandering and ensure their safety. Additionally, staff members are often specially trained to handle emergency situations and provide assistance to residents as needed, further enhancing their safety and well-being.

What qualifications and training do staff members in memory care communities have?

Staff members in Belleview, FL's memory care communities typically undergo specialized training to effectively care for residents with memory-related conditions. This training often includes courses in dementia care, Alzheimer's disease understanding, crisis intervention, and communication skills. Additionally, staff members may be required to have certifications in CPR and First Aid to ensure they can respond to emergencies promptly and appropriately.
